# Plugin Signing — GateTally Turnstile Counter

GateTally counts turnstile entries at Verrow Field venues. All third-party plugins must be signed or the loader rejects them. Build against SDK 2.x, run the conformance suite, then submit the signed bundle to the Verrow plugin registry. Verify your signature locally before upload using the platform key below.

deploy key for kajof-fajop: bky6_gDHw9Q

14:22 — Partner files stopped landing in the Bramblegate SFTP drop. Ingest worker logged zero new objects for three consecutive polls, which tripped the staleness alarm. Root cause was a host key rotation on the partner side that our client rejected silently; the connection retried and died without surfacing an error. Fix pins the new key fingerprint and adds an explicit failure metric. Reviewer should verify the patched ingest image, whose build token follows.

pipeline stamp: htk9_ce63042d9

Handover: Rillfex currency conversion. Plugin authors keep hitting rounding errors because FX rates are applied before minor-unit truncation. Fix landed in converter-core; half-even rounding is now enforced at the boundary. Do not round in your plugin. Ownership moves from Dario to Quenna this sprint. Plugins must load the service settings exactly as shipped, reproduced here.

deployment values, yadug-bawif:
[framir]
team = pelox
access_code = ac_a38ab2
owner = tamion.julael
host = framir.tolvaqlabs.test
port = 11211
peer = tammir.zemvargrid.local
salt = 2215ef03
pin = 1541

**Mgmt Meeting Minutes — Retiring the Brightline Range**

Quick recap for sales leads at Fenholt Supplies: we agreed to retire the Brightline fixture range by year-end. Remaining stock moves to clearance pricing next month, and accounts on standing orders get migrated to the Lumetta range. Trade-in incentives were approved in principle. The confidential note on next steps sits just below.

board note of bajof-bajeg: The pricing group signed off on a budget of $13.4 million for Project Sildor. The renewal with Lamixek Holdings closes at $48.9 million a year, 49 percent above the last contract.